Just minutes away from the River Thames with its delightful views and walkways, and well under half a mile from the lively town centre, Kings Quarter is an attractive new neighbourhood of apartments and houses. Just two miles from the M4, and with good rail links to Paddington Station, the development combines its pleasant market town ambience with easy commuting to central London.

Leisure
In addition to the many parks and green spaces, including picturesque riverside walkways along the Thames to charming neighbouring villages, Maidenhead has an 18-hole golf-course close to the town centre. Indoor amenities include the Magnet Leisure Centre, around 500 yards from the development, which includes a 25-metre swimming pool, two sports halls, a BodyZone gym and a health suite. The Superbowl, adjacent to the Magnet Centre, offers a large selection of video games and simulators as well as ten-pin bowling. There is a ten-screen Odeon cinema in the town centre, and Maidenhead and the surrounding area has a wide selection of restaurants, cafes and traditional country pubs.

Education
There is a good choice of schools in easy reach of Kings Quarter, including four primary schools within around a mile of the development.
Shopping
There is a Co-op convenience store virtually adjacent to the development in Bridge Road, and an excellent choice of food and drink retailers, including a Waitrose and a Sainsbury’s supermarket, in easy reach. In the town centre, Nicholson’s Shopping Centre presents a selection of over 60 shops, ranging from famous high street names to independent traders, within two modern covered malls. Maidenhead also has a Farmers’ Market held on the second Sunday of each month.
Transport
Kings Quarter is around two miles from the M4, giving easy access to central London around 30 miles away. Maidenhead Station has a frequent rail service to London Paddington, with the journey taking around 40 minutes, and Heathrow Airport is only 14 miles away.
